Alubari
Alubari is a village located in Diphu subdivision of Karbi Anglong district in Assam, India. It is situated 53km away from Diphu, which is both district & sub-district headquarter of Alubari village.

About Alubari
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Alubari is 296276. The village spans a total geographical area of 80 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 782480. Bokajan is nearest town to Alubari village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 2km away.

Population of Alubari
According to the 2011 Census, Alubari has a total population of about 647, with approximately 333 males and 314 females. The sex ratio is around 942 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 94 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 5 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 12. The overall literacy rate is approximately 62.29%, with male literacy at about 66.37% and female literacy near 57.96%. There are around 136 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 647 | 333 | 314 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 94 | 52 | 42 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 5 | 3 | 2 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 12 | 6 | 6 |
Literate Population | 403 | 221 | 182 |
Illiterate Population | 244 | 112 | 132 |
Connectivity of Alubari
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Alubari. As per the 2011 stats, Alubari had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within <5 km distance |
